What you'll see and do
Experience a deep dive into the history of the 1944 Normandy Landings. This visit includes your entrance ticket and a professional audioguide. You will explore an unrivaled collection of over 10,000 artifacts, including legendary Sherman tanks and military vehicles. The immersive dioramas bring the logistics and the human reality of the Battle of Normandy to life, providing the perfect historical context before we head to the nearby beaches.
60 minutes here · Admission included
Cimetiere Americain de Colleville-sur-Mer
Pay your respects at the Normandy American Cemetery, a site of profound peace overlooking the English Channel. We will spend one hour walking through this 170-acre memorial, honoring the 9,387 fallen soldiers. You will see the famous "Spirit of American Youth Rising from the Waves" bronze statue, the memorial colonnade, and the viewpoint offering a breathtaking panoramic look at the "Bloody Omaha" landing sector. This is a moment of deep reflection on the cost of freedom, set against the stunning backdrop of the Alabaster Coast.
60 minutes here · Admission included
Abbaye du Mont-Saint-Michel
Discover the "Wonder of the West." Your priority entrance ticket and audioguide for the world-famous Benedictine Abbey are included. You will explore the architectural masterpiece at the summit, blending Romanesque and Gothic styles. After the visit, enjoy free time to wander through the steep, narrow medieval streets of the village, browse artisan shops, and witness the incredible tides of the bay. This 3-hour stop allows for a deep discovery of this UNESCO site before our silent, comfortable return to Paris in the Tesla.
